Novooleksandrivka (Ukrainian: Новоолександрівка; Russian: Новоалександровка) is a village in Pokrovsk urban hromada, Pokrovsk Raion, Donetsk Oblast, eastern Ukraine. It is located 62.78 kilometres (39.01 mi) north-northwest (NNW) from the centre of Donetsk city. It belongs to Pokrovsk urban hromada, one of the hromadas of Ukraine.
Geography
The village borders with Solona river, a tributary of the Vovcha river. The absolute height is 96 metres above sea level.
History
The settlement was founded in 1889.
Russian invasion of Ukraine
The village was captured by Russian forces in May 2025, during the full-scale Russian invasion of Ukraine.[2]
Demographics
As of the 2001 Ukrainian census, the settlement had 135 inhabitants, whose native languages were 94.20% Ukrainian, 5.07% Russian and 0.72 Belarusian.[1]
